The Frame
The bill changes the legal requirements for wildfire suppression by removing the need for National Pollutant Discharge Elimination System (NPDES) permits, which currently regulate the discharge of chemicals into waterways, for federal and local firefighting agencies.
Potentially affected actors named in the source documents. Mention is not a position.
Federal firefighting agencies
These agencies are granted authority to use fire retardants without obtaining specific water pollution permits.
State and local governments
These entities are included in the definition of 'covered entity' and are exempt from specific water pollution permitting requirements for firefighting activities.
Tribal governments
Tribal governments are included in the definition of 'covered entity' and are exempt from specific water pollution permitting requirements for firefighting activities.

Regulatory Exemption for Firefighting
The bill creates a broad, categorical exemption from the Clean Water Act's permitting process for a wide range of government and tribal entities involved in fire management.
